Transaction 43b9dae66e90442f424b91497d1710974721412687a7661b93aa2441c5ff1641
1 Input
1 Output
-
43b9dae66e90442f424b91497d1710974721412687a7661b93aa2441c5ff1641:0
- value
- 12945470
- script pubkey
- OP_0 OP_PUSHBYTES_20 af62a52cb45b73dff0332a052b204cb8f1e42b5d
- address
- bc1q4a322t95tdealupn9gzjkgzvhrc7g26anjgxa8